Transaction e733358d0388446a321115368ad76ce2fc0a6f21760a63ed0eba5869a83ebb52
1 Input
1 Output
-
e733358d0388446a321115368ad76ce2fc0a6f21760a63ed0eba5869a83ebb52:0
- value
- 291716
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3d97ecaa89e392735c433e1d29b762108d1e36a OP_EQUAL
- address
- 3KYaEndvqiSLSyuf8aoyf5KE48Z9isddrJ